    Position Summary

    The Advancement Operations Associate is responsible for supporting the process of data-driven decision making to improve the effectiveness of North Central College's fundraising and engagement activities.

    This position will report to the Director of Development and will provide reliable and timely quantitative data aligned with the College's philanthropic activities including, but not limited to, the annual solicitation and engagement sequence, gift processing, and ongoing assurance of data integrity and accuracy.

    The Advancement Operations Associate is a key cross-functional partner within the Office of Institutional Advancement and will support the Director of Development in all aspects of the College's fundraising and engagement initiatives by providing critical insights and applying data analytics to better understand fundraising progress and results.

    Description of Key Responsibilities

    Assist the Director of Development in creating an efficient and effective data-driven philanthropic activity management system, and developing the data-based solutions to support key fundraising initiatives and campaigns.

    Provide fundraising and engagement analytics as needed to help the College assess philanthropic performance and adherence to stewardship best practices.


    Examples include but are not limited to:

    monthly performance reports, proactive prospect recommendations, analysis and reporting on pledge reminders, scholarship fund reports & reconciliation of academic department restricted funds.

    Understand the data structures within


    CRM


    Advance to audit and monitor data elements for consistency and accuracy and compliance with the North Central College fundraising policy.

    Partner with Advancement Services to ensure integrity of gift processing and application of best practices and gift acceptance policy as well as proper reporting and recognition.

    Provide assistance in gift entry/data management and maintain online giving forms as needed.

    In partnership with others on the Institutional Advancement team, monitor and manage a stage aging/moves management system based upon targeted research that drives mutually agreed upon cultivation and solicitation strategies for donors and prospects.

    Conduct research to identify and qualify annual and major gift prospects in response to specific requests made by the President, the VP for Institutional Advancement, the Executive Director of Institutional Advancement and others.

    Partner with fundraisers to help create donor overview briefs and/or donor profiles while maintaining standards of privacy and confidentiality with all data.

    Manage existing dashboards and reports that pertain to Institutional Advancement operations and individual Gift Officer productivity and performance analysis, and assess portfolio penetration, proposal yield rates, and stage aging on a regular basis.

    Conduct fundraising trend and regression analyses and forecast expected outcomes.

    As part of fundraising trend and gift analysis, collaborate with the entire Advancement Team to ensure accuracy of data entry and enforce good data entry practices.

    Stay current with computer technology, best practices, and research methodologies, as well as news and other trends that impact fundraising, prospect management and research.
